Hellraider (06/30/2009 07:21pm):
Exchange the southwest and the northeast base so that the frontline is not so linear. There
is no reason for the ports to be ghostunit'd, since it is good to see sea units once in a while.
Furthermore, while it is lame and doesn't fit the theme of the map, I'd like it if you would get
rid of the two silo tiles since they usually have a negative effect on the gameplay.

Also, the usual FTA counter on 3-base maps is 1 FTA counter infantry and one preowned
property for the army going second.

You might rethink the positions of the airports, they aren't bad but they don't add anything
interesting atm.
